What do I do for a living?

Software Quality Assurance

I believe that if you’re taught to think like an engineer, you can successfully do almost any kind of engineering. That’s why despite different academic background software testing is my everyday job. Since 2006 I’m a certified ISEB Foundation Level software tester, and since the end of 2007 I have had ISEB Certificate of Practitioner in Software Testing. I’m specialized in functional, high-level testing (acceptance tests, end-user testing), but I’m also experienced in QA activities regarding the whole software production life cycle (Agile, Lean and other methodologies). In early 2009 I have completed Scrum Master certification training and since that time I act also as Scrum Master in agile software development organization. Due to new professional experiences and challenges I continuously improve my skills in defining and introducing Quality Assurance processes and Error Management including Kanban approach.

Telecommunication journalism & blogging

I’m passionate about telecom solutions, services and devices, especially mobile ones. I like sharing my knowledge, interests, or opinions about these areas of technology, therefore in 2000 I started my adventure with telecommunication journalism, working for non-existing portal FKN.pl. Since 2004 I’ve been writing both technical and commentary articles for the biggest Polish telecom paper magazine “Twoja Komórka”. I also occasionally has published in “Chip” and “Mobility” magazines. Since 2008 I also enjoy a role of an active blogger, proudly running NokiaE71 blog which in less then 2 years had over 1,5 million hits!

Sport journalism

One of the newest chapters in my professional development is a work as a freelance sport reporter for “Magazyn Rowerowy” where I publish both cycling hardware reviews and commentary about cycling events. I was given this chance after winning magazine’ contest for the best bike marathon reportage.

Biotechnology

In 2006 I graduated from the Faculty of Chemistry at Wroclaw University of Technology with degree of Master of Science in Biotechnology. My master thesis was about environment pollution with pol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s). I stay actively interested in newest research, publications and papers in this area.

Sailing

My first real job was working as Sailing Instructor on summer holiday camps. I truly liked this job because it combined both passion and responsibility. Currently I don’t have much time and opportunity for this activity, but I’m still proud of my first professional experience.
